Spreitenbach Centre

The largest shopping mall in Switzerland with connecting bridge between the extension and the old building was effectively put in a new light by the architect and designer Matteo Thun, who used Focalflood varychrome floodlights to provide the right setting.

The bridge connects two previously autarkic shopping centres and combines them into the largest mall in Switzerland. The coloured, DALI-controlled effect lighting using Focalflood varychrome floodlights is provided by 60 Stella spotlights on Hi-trac tracks, which vividly illuminate the transition. Fluorescent lamps and metal halide lamps ensure low energy and maintenance costs.
